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Dwarf Fat-tailed Jerboa | Ecuadorean Spiny Pocket M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Mammalia (Säugetiere) |
| Order same | Rodentia (Nagetiere) | Rodentia (Nagetiere) |
| Family | Dipodidae | Heteromyidae |
| Genus | Pygeretmus | Heteromys |
| Species | Pygeretmus pumilio | Heteromys teleus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Dwarf Fat-tailed Jerboa and Ecuadorean Spiny Pocket Mouse share a common ancestor at the Order level: Rodentia. (Nagetiere)
